## Releases

Splitgate Assigner is versioned with strict semver; assignment-hash changes always bump the major version, since they reshuffle experiment buckets. To cut a release, tag the commit, let the Ferrow CI pipeline build the container, and confirm the bucket-distribution smoke test passes on the Pellworth staging cluster before promoting. Never promote a build whose assignment snapshot differs from the tagged manifest. All release artifacts must be signed prior to registry push; the current release signing key is as follows.

rollout seal: bky19_M1Zvn1YQwEBTy4XxP3H

Welcome to the support rotation! One tool you'll bump into a lot is Lintwright, our documentation linter. It flags broken snippets, stale screenshots, and missing front matter before docs ship. Most tickets about it are false positives — check the rules wiki first. If something looks genuinely broken, reach the Lintwright maintainers here.

billing contact of yawip-yadup = druath.casdor@nelvrolabs.internal

## Changed: `CRON_RUNNER_MODE` is now `FLOWHATCH_ENGINE_MODE`

Heads up, new folks — we've finished moving the old cron jobs over to Flowhatch, our workflow engine, so the legacy setting name is gone. If you see `CRON_RUNNER_MODE` in any env file, rename it; the old name is silently ignored as of v3.2. While you're editing that file, Flowhatch also needs its API credential, which goes on the line directly below the mode setting.

vault entry, kagep-yajeg: COURIER_KEY5=da097

## Ticket: Config drift in GridPane bulk-edit settings

If you're new to the team: GridPane is the admin table used by Orbella support staff, and its bulk-edit limits are supposed to match across all environments. They currently don't. Staging allows 500-row bulk edits while production caps at 200, which explains the inconsistent timeout reports from last week. Please reconcile every environment against the canonical settings. For reference, the values the service should be running with are listed below.

service settings:
[ulair]
team = praath
access_code = ac_06d704
owner = wenix.ulair
host = ulair.qirvancorp.corp
port = 9200
peer = sorys.nelvronet.internal
salt = 2668132c
pin = 9140